Thank you @ganigeorgiev for the response. And thank you @benallfree for including my project in your awesome list. Actually, I just pushed a config-driven hooks system to my project repo. Which means you can now enter a record into a "hooks" table indicating which event (insert/update/delete) on which table should trigger a command or a webhook post. Example: run a script when a record is updated in the "posts" table Example: post to a webhook when a record is updated in the "posts" table I learned a lot about handling pipes and external command execution in Go routines in the process. Hopefully, people find it useful. |
